Cost Overview
Without insurance, inpatient drug rehab in Kentucky typically ranges from $5,000 to $30,000 for a 30-day program. Factors that affect cost include the level of medical care required, program amenities, location, and length of stay. Medical detox adds to the cost due to 24-hour medical monitoring and medication. Extended programs (60 or 90 days) cost proportionally more but produce better outcomes. With insurance, out-of-pocket costs are significantly lower โ often limited to deductibles and copayments.
Factors Affecting Treatment Cost
Several factors influence the total cost of inpatient treatment. The level of medical care โ programs requiring physician oversight and medication management cost more than non-medical programs. Program length โ 90-day programs cost more than 30-day programs but have better outcomes. Location and amenities โ luxury or resort-style programs cost significantly more than standard clinical programs. The type of substance โ detox from alcohol or benzodiazepines requires more intensive medical monitoring than stimulant detox. Co-occurring conditions โ dual diagnosis treatment involves additional psychiatric services.
How Insurance Reduces Costs
The Mental Health Parity and Addiction Equity Act requires insurance plans to cover addiction treatment at parity with other medical conditions. PPO insurance plans typically cover medical detox, residential treatment (usually approved in 7 to 14-day increments based on medical necessity), individual and group therapy, psychiatric evaluation, medication management, and aftercare planning. Your actual out-of-pocket cost depends on your deductible, copayment or coinsurance percentage, and annual out-of-pocket maximum.
Financing Options
For costs not covered by insurance, several financing options may be available. Payment plans allow you to spread the cost over months. Healthcare credit lines (such as CareCredit) provide medical financing with promotional interest rates. Health savings accounts (HSAs) and flexible spending accounts (FSAs) can be used for addiction treatment. Some employers offer Employee Assistance Programs (EAPs) that cover initial treatment costs.
